Kerry says Russia, Syria violating UN resolution

Russia and Syria are not in compliance with a United Nations resolution on humanitarian aid and an end to aerial bombardment on civilians, US Secretary of State John Kerry said Friday.

"This has to stop. Nobody has any question about that. But it's not going to stop just by whining about it. It's not going to stop by walking away from the table or not engaging," Kerry said at a joint press conference with Colombia President Juan Manuel Santos.

The third round of Syria peace talks, launched earlier this week amid intensive global attention, ground to a halt Wednesday night. UN Special Envoy for Syria Staffan de Mistura said the talks would resume no later than Feb. 25.

On Thursday, Kerry and his Russian counterpart Sergei Lavrov agreed to resume Syrian talks in Geneva, Switzerland, as soon as possible during a phone call.

"While expressing common regret over the fact that the UN-brokered intra-Syrian dialogue has been temporarily suspended, Lavrov and Kerry agreed to make necessary efforts to ensure that this pause is as short as possible," said an online statement of the Russian Foreign Ministry.


  • "The next days will tell the story of whether or not people are serious or people are not serious," Kerry said Friday.

The top US diplomat said the Russians have made some constructive ideas about how a ceasefire could be implemented.

"But if it's just talk for the sake of talk in order to continue the bombing, nobody's going to accept that," he said. "And we will know that in the course of the next days."
